Woody is an Award-Winning professional with multiple years of production experience at the Broadcast Network level along with Syndication Programs and Independent Feature films. His knowledge and experience includes productions with either film or video formats and from an array of locations that include: Israel, Australia, Paris and Normandy, France, Hawaii, Alaska, that includes outstanding USA programming that includes Live concerts, Music Videos for MTV and BBC plus Network and Syndicated Sports Shows to Award Winning Documentaries.  He has functioned as Director/Producer that include camera configurations of Single-Camera to Multi-Camera productions both "live and recorded with crews of 150 or more and including demanding or unusual remote locations from the Talkeetna Mountain Ranges in Alaska, to the Sandy Deserts in Israel or the plush concert halls i.e. Carnegie Hall NYC, and the Sydney Opera House in Australia.

His production career began in Washington, DC as a production-assistant with WTOP-TV and CBS-News Network. In three short years climbed the ranks to occupy a seat as staff-director with a list of programming that included such well-known Broadcasts as Face the Nation, CBS Evening News, World News Roundup (Radio), The Ranger Hal Show (children's), Lyndon Johnson documentaries, The Washington Symphony Concerts, and more. During three of the 10 years with CBS, he also served double duty as the production-manager for all Studio and Location Remote programming in addition to directing his daily and weekly shows routines.

Following the Washington experience, he was transferred to CBS, Television City in Hollywood, where he became involved in more of the "entertainment" spectrum of the business.

In the early 80's Woody, along with two partners, formed the independent production company September Moon Production Network that produced more Award-Winning productions that included ESPN Sports, Detroit Lions Football, PGA Senior Golf Tour, The Saturn Movie, Hurricane Andrew Documentary, The World Cup Opening-Ceremonies-ABC Sports, The US-Arab Economic Summit and broadcast "live" by all major television networks including Sky Vision, Live concerts with LeAnn Rimes, Reba McIntyre sponsored by General Motors, The Olympic Soccer Opening Ceremonies 96' Atlanta-NBC Sports, and Syndicated programming of independent productions for MGM-UA with Marie Osmond, the weekly syndicated series with Dr. Tim LaHaye author of the Left Behind best-selling book series from Osmond Entertainment Provo, Utah and directed the Detroit-Windsor film-festival honoring America's Greatest Crime writer Elmore (Dutch) Leonard, the Stanley Cup Ceremonies for the Detroit Red Wings, "live" on the NHL Network and produced marketing and promotional campaigns for the American Indy Car Racing Series.

In 2005, Woody sold his interests in the production company and became involved in Feature-Film productions in Michigan with the introduction of the 2008 Feature Film incentives endorsed by the State Legislature. More recently, completed the independent film "Sucker" (starring Michael Manasseri from the hit TV series Weird Science) as the (UPM) Unit Production Manager, for Big Screen Michigan, a division of Big Screen Entertainment Group-Hollywood and distribution thru Warner Bros Entertainment. Also appeared as a featured extra with Clint Eastwood in Gran Tourino. Currently, is contracted for positions in three upcoming features to be lensed in Michigan the summer and fall of 2010.
